TROPICAL FRUIT DIP



Tropical Fruit Dip image

Be the potluck hero with a dip that's sweet, tart and a Healthy Living recipe, too! Bring tropical fruit-and a paper umbrella, if you've got one!

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 5m

Yield 16 servings, 2 Tbsp. each

Number Of Ingredients 2

2 cups plain nonfat Greek-style yogurt
1 pkt. CRYSTAL LIGHT On The Go Drink Mix, any flavor

Steps:

  • Mix ingredients until drink mix is completely dissolved.

CRYSTAL LIGHT TROPICAL FRUIT DIP



Crystal Light Tropical Fruit Dip image

Make and share this Crystal Light Tropical Fruit Dip recipe from Food.com.

Provided by bmcnichol

Categories     Fruit

Time 10m

Yield 32 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 2

1 (1 ounce) container Crystal Light strawberry kiwi powdered drink mix (small tub)
4 cups low-fat vanilla yogurt

Steps:

  • Stir drink mix and yogurt in bowl until well blended.
  • Serve with fresh fruit.

TROPICAL FRUIT DIP



Tropical Fruit Dip image

Relates field editor Suzanne Strocsher of Bothell, Washington, "This is a refreshing snack. I love coconut and use any excuse to make this yummy dip."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 15m

Yield about 1-1/2 cups.

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ups 4% cottage cheese
1/4 cup lemon yogurt or flavor of your choice
3 to 4 tablespoons honey
1 teaspoon grated orange zest
2 tablespoons sweetened shredded coconut, toasted
Assorted fresh fruit

Steps:

  • Place the cottage cheese and yogurt in a blender; cover and process until smooth. Stir in honey and orange zest. Pour into a serving dish.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our. Sprinkle with coconut. Serve with fruit.

Tips:

  • For a thicker dip, use less milk or yogurt.
  • For a sweeter dip, add more sugar or honey.
  • For a tangier dip, add more lemon juice or lime juice.
  • For a creamier dip, use full-fat milk or yogurt.
  • For a healthier dip, use low-fat or fat-free milk or yogurt and natural sweeteners like honey or maple syrup.
  • Serve the dip with a variety of fruits, such as pineapple, mango, papaya, and strawberries.
  • Garnish the dip with chopped nuts, shredded coconut, or fresh mint.
  • Make the dip 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
